An effective teacher would have to be an individual that is patient, understanding, knowledgeable, and caring. A teacher has to acknowledge that every child not matter what race, gender, or religion has the right to an education. In looking back to when I was younger, my teacher was my facilitator as well as a motivator. They opened your eyes to the world around you, and to the information that was out there that you never knew about.

It is the main objective of a teacher to embrace every different learning style. As an effective teacher you have to understand there are many different learning styles. Many students may be visual learners and others maybe hands-on. It is the job of the teacher to determine, what learning style will work for the majority of the class. The different learning styles may derive from the student’s background and culture at home. The teacher in this case would have to be accommodating to the needs of the student.

The classroom and school environment plays a major role in teaching and learning. The school setting should be comfortable and accommodating to every students needs. Students should feel safe and secure at school, because they spend most of their time beside at home in a classroom setting. The school environment should be related by administrators, which include setting roles and regulations that should be followed by everyone. This ensures the safety of both students and facilitators. The classroom setting should include materials that are going to be useful for every student. The main utility that is used in many classrooms today is some form of technology. Technology today is more advanced than ever before.

Technology in the classroom is most effective, when used properly. All faculty members should be trained on the right way to use computers, smart boards and projectors. This ensures that all students are being taught efficiently and correctly. It also limits the amount of time teachers; have to stop due to not knowing the proper way to use different materials in the classroom.

As a teacher I would incorporate a lot of hands-on activities. I feel students tend to learn better if they are about to deal with the material hands-on. I would also incorporate a lot of technology into my classroom. I would have students do more projects using Excel and PowerPoint, so they begin to familiarize themselves with it. As a teacher I would want to make sure all of my students all receive the same education, and become very successful individuals in the future.
